Designing the Perfect Peafowl Habitat
Designing a functional yet beautiful aviary requires careful planning. Here are essential design elements to consider:
Size and Space Allocation
The size of your peacock aviary directly impacts bird health and behavior. A minimum of 100 square feet per peacock is recommended for adequate room to display and move freely. For larger groups, consider a proportional increase to prevent overcrowding, which can lead to stress and poor health.
Height and Vertical Space
Peacocks are large birds that thrive in open environments. Incorporate tall structures, at least 8-10 feet high, to allow for flying, courtship displays, and roosting. Vertical space also facilitates better airflow and reduces humidity buildup.
Access and Entry Points
Secure, easy-to-operate gates and doors are essential for regular maintenance, cleaning, and bird health monitoring. Multi-lock systems prevent escapes and ensure predator protection.
Coverings and Shelter
Incorporate shaded zones, shaded netting, or pergolas to provide shelter from harsh sunlight and weather conditions. This encourages natural behaviors and comfort.
Flooring and Ground Features
Use natural substrates like soil mixed with gravel or sand, promoting digging and foraging. Incorporate water features like small ponds or shallow baths for hydration and bathing, which are vital for their health.

Step-by-step construction guide:
1. Planning and Foundation
Mark out the area based on your design. Clear the land, level the ground, and create a stable foundation with concrete footings or treated wood for the base frame.
2. Frame Assembly
Construct the perimeter and internal support structures using heavy-duty metal pipes or tubing. Ensure all joints are reinforced and securely connected.
3. Attaching the Mesh
Cut the metal mesh sections to fit each panel. Attach the mesh securely to the frame with stainless steel clips, fasteners, or welding, ensuring there are no gaps or sharp edges.
4. Installing Doors and Locks
Incorporate access points with secure locking mechanisms. Doors should be large enough for easy cleaning and bird access, and locks should prevent escape or predator intrusion.
5. Adding Shelter and Enrichment Features
Install perches, nesting boxes, and shaded areas made from durable materials. These enrich the birds’ environment, promoting natural behaviors.
6. Final Inspection and Safety Checks
Walk through the entire aviary, checking for loose connections, sharp edges, or weak points. Make necessary adjustments to guarantee safety and durability.
Environmental & Climate Considerations for Your Peacock Aviary
Peacocks originate from warm, tropical and subtropical regions, so replicating these conditions is vital in non-native environments. Proper climate control enhances their well-being and reduces disease susceptibility.
- Ventilation: Adequate airflow prevents humidity build-up and maintains air quality.
- Shade & Sunlight: Balance shaded areas with direct sunlight exposure for Vitamin D synthesis.
- Protection from Elements: Windbreaks, rainproof roofing, and wind shields will safeguard your peacocks from adverse weather.
- Heating & Cooling: In extreme climates, consider heat lamps or misting systems as needed.
Feeding & Care Inside the Aviary
Providing a balanced diet, clean water, and environmental enrichment is essential. Incorporate:
- High-quality peafowl pellets or grains enriched with vitamins and minerals
- Fresh fruits and vegetables for supplemental nutrients
- Clean and frequent water supply for drinking and bathing
- Natural forage options like seeds, insects, and greens
- Perches and display areas to encourage natural posturing and social interaction
Regular health checks and prompt veterinary care are critical for maintaining healthy, vibrant peacocks.

Building a Peafowl Community: Social and Breeding Considerations
Peacocks are social and thrive in groups with a dominant male and several females. Proper social structuring within your aviary will foster natural behaviors and breeding success. Design segregated zones for breeding pairs, and include ample space to prevent aggression. To enhance the breeding environment, consider providing secluded nesting spots and appropriate diet supplements to bolster fertility.
